On the basis of their appearance under a light microscope, leukocytes helminth infection macrophage grouped into three major classeslymphocytes, granulocytes and monocyteseach of which carries out somewhat different functions. Lymphocytes, which are further divided into B and T cells, are responsible for the specific recognition of foreign agents and their subsequent removal paraziții de reacție sunt uciși the host.

B lymphocytes secrete antibodies, which are proteins that bind to foreign microorganisms in body tissues and mediate their destruction.

On helminth infection monocytes basis of how their granules take up dye in the laboratory, granulocytes are subdivided into three categories: neutrophils, eosinophils and basophils. The most numerous of the granulocytesmaking up 50 to 80 percent of all leukocytesare neutrophils. They are often one of the first cell types to arrive at a site of infection, where they engulf and destroy the infectious microorganisms through a process called phagocytosis.

Eosinophils and basophils, as well as the tissue cells called mast cells, typically arrive later. The granules of basophils and of the closely related mast cells contain a number of chemicals, including histamine helminth infection macrophage leukotrienes, that are important in inducing allergic inflammatory responses.

Eosinophils destroy parasites and also help to modulate inflammatory responses.

Monocytes, which constitute up to 7 percent of the total number of white blood cells in the blood, move from the blood to sites of infection, where they differentiate further into macrophages. Some macrophages are important as antigen-presenting cells, cells that phagocytose and degrade microbes and present portions of these organisms to T lymphocytes, thereby activating the specific acquired immune response.

In general, newborns have a high white blood cell count that gradually falls to the adult level during childhood. An exception is the lymphocyte count, which is low at birth, reaches its highest levels in the first four years of life and thereafter falls gradually to a stable adult level.
